Best Data Science Tools for Non-Programmers
Essential Data Science Tools for Complete Beginners
This guide is specifically designed for beginners who want to start their data science journey without extensive programming knowledge or advanced technical background.
Primary Categories of Data Science Tools
Data Collection and Organization
Tools primarily used to contain and keep data safe after it has been collected. Essential for maintaining data integrity and structure.
Database Management
Used to store, prepare, and annotate data in a way that makes it easier to search, analyze, and understand.
Data Exploration and Analysis
Tools to uncover relationships between data, patterns, trends, and other information which can be extrapolated from datasets.
Data Modeling and Visualization
Offer aesthetically pleasing options for communicating data through different types of graphs, charts, and other representation methods.
The following tools work together as a comprehensive toolkit that can be used to complete a data science project from start to finish, specifically chosen for their beginner-friendly approach.
Microsoft Excel for Data Science
Using MySQL for Data Organization
Import Data
Easily import CSV files from Excel into the MySQL platform for database management
Clean and Organize
Use MySQL tools to clean and organize your data for better structure and accessibility
Create Tables and Search
Create organized tables, search data efficiently, and identify missing or unnecessary data
Language Integration
Integrate with other programming languages like R and Python using language-specific packages
Why Python is Ideal for Beginners
English-Based Syntax
Based on English keywords and commands, making it easier to read and write code without extensive computer science background.
Extensive Community Support
Hundreds of thousands of online resources, libraries, and step-by-step instructions available for data science projects.
Minimal Training Required
Learning Python requires little prior training or education in computer science or statistics compared to other programming languages.
Tableau's Versatile Capabilities
Data Preparation
Use Tableau to prepare and structure your data for analysis and visualization
Data Analysis
Perform comprehensive analysis using Tableau's built-in analytical capabilities
Drag and Drop Visualization
Create visualizations using intuitive drag and drop selections from preset menu functions
Multi-Language Compatibility
Integrate with multiple programming languages while maintaining user-friendly interface
Jupyter Notebook Benefits
Collaboration Platform
Create and share code with others, making it ideal for team projects and collaborative data science work.
Multi-Language Support
Complete projects in multiple programming languages within a single platform, offering flexibility for different project needs.
Educational Standard
Widely used in online and offline classroom settings, making it essential for students pursuing formal data science education.
Next Steps for Learning Data Science Tools
Start with familiar tools to build confidence in data handling
Essential skill for working with larger datasets and database systems
Learn professional-grade data visualization and presentation techniques
Develop programming capabilities for more sophisticated data analysis
Gain experience in industry-standard development environments
Select the learning environment that best suits your schedule and preferences
Key Takeaways
RELATED ARTICLES
Why Every Data Scientist Should Know Scikit-Learn
Dive into the potential of Python through its comprehensive open-source libraries, with a focus on data science libraries like NumPy and Matplotlib, as well as...
Why Data Scientists Should Learn JavaScript
JavaScript is not typically associated with data science, but it's a valuable tool that data scientists can utilize for creating unique data visualizations and...
Data Science vs. Information Technology: Industry and Careers
Discover the complex relationship between data science and information technology, examining their similarities, differences, and how their skills can be...